2. Heard Sri Deepak Chowdary, learned counsel for the petitioner and Sri N.Sreedhar Reddy, learned Standing Counsel for Southern Power Distribution Company of Telangana Limited, for the respondents. With their consent, this Writ Petition is taken up for disposal at admission stage.

3.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the present impugned demand notices dated 04.O2.2O25, 19.O5.2025 and

02.06.2025, issued by respondent No.2 for payment of Rs. 1,91,46,297/ towards Cross Subsidy Surcharge, is contrary to the common order of a Division Bench of this Court dated 79.12.2023 in c P(,.I wPNo lsc? I of2023 W.P.Nos. 14918 of 2OO6 and batch, wherein, the Divirrion Bench had set aside the impugned demand notices therein, h olding that they were issued in violation of the Electricity (Remova I of Difficulties) Second O:der, 2005. Therefore, the petitionr:- submitted its representalrions to respondent No.2 on 14.02.2025 ,:rnd 29.O5.2O25, requesting to rvithdrau, the impugned demand notic:r: and not to take further action. However. no action has been taken thereon so far. It is further submitted thal in similar circumstances Lhis Court ulde order dated 20.o2.20'25 in w.P.No.5098 cl1 2(l-'5, directcd the respondent.s therein to consider and pass appropri.rl: orders on the representat-ion of the petitioner therein. Therefore. . earned counsel for the pedtioner prays this Court to pass a sint lirr order in the presenl Writ I't'tit icrn also.

4. Learned Standing Counsel for the respondct'tt r; fairl1, submits respondenl No.2 will consider the representations t>-the petitioner, dated 14.C2.202.5 and 29.05.2025, and pass app:rl)riate orders in accordalce with law.'

5. Having regard to the submissions made by le':rrned counsel for the respective parties, this Writ Petition is disposed of directing respondenl- No.2 to consider the representations of the petitioner, 3 PI<, J w P No 15921 of 2025 daLed 14.02.2025 and 29.05.2025, and pass appropriate orders thereon, strictly in accordance with law, as expeditiously as possible, preferably within a period of two (02) we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order and communicate a copy therlof to the petitioner.
